Market Segmentation in the Arthroscopic Devices Market
Understanding the detailed market segmentation within the Arthroscopic Devices Market is essential for identifying growth opportunities and tailoring strategies. The market is broadly segmented based on product type, application, end-user, and geography. Product-wise, the market is divided into arthroscopes, shavers, radiofrequency devices, and accessories such as cannulas and probes.
Arthroscopes hold the largest market share due to their critical role in providing visual access during surgeries. The development of high-definition and 4K arthroscopes has further boosted their adoption, enhancing surgical precision. Shavers and radiofrequency devices are experiencing rapid growth as they enable efficient tissue removal and coagulation, respectively. For instance, the radiofrequency devices segment is growing at a CAGR of over 7%, driven by their expanding use in soft tissue surgeries and pain management.
Application-wise, knee arthroscopy dominates the market, accounting for over 40% of total demand. This dominance is linked to the high prevalence of knee injuries and degenerative conditions such as osteoarthritis. Shoulder arthroscopy follows closely, supported by increasing sports-related injuries and aging populations in developed countries. Other applications include hip, wrist, and ankle arthroscopies, which are gaining traction due to the growing awareness of minimally invasive joint surgeries.
End-users primarily include hospitals, ambulatory surgical centers, and orthopedic clinics. Hospitals remain the largest segment given their comprehensive surgical capabilities and access to advanced arthroscopic technologies. However, ambulatory surgical centers are witnessing higher growth rates due to the trend of performing arthroscopic procedures on an outpatient basis, reducing costs and enhancing patient convenience. This shift significantly impacts the Arthroscopic Devices Market by diversifying end-user demand and fostering innovation in device portability and usability.
Price Trends and Economic Factors Influencing the Arthroscopic Devices Market
Price dynamics within the Arthroscopic Devices Market are influenced by factors such as raw material costs, technological complexity, and regional economic conditions. For example, the introduction of disposable arthroscopic devices has led to a bifurcation in pricing strategies, with premium devices commanding higher prices due to advanced features, while cost-effective disposable alternatives cater to budget-sensitive markets.
Technological advancements tend to increase device prices initially; however, economies of scale in Arthroscopic Devices Manufacturing gradually lower costs over time. For instance, the adoption of automated production lines and streamlined supply chains has reduced the average manufacturing cost per unit by approximately 10-15% in recent years. These savings are often passed on to healthcare providers, making arthroscopic procedures more accessible and affordable.
Regional price variations are notable in the Arthroscopic Devices Market. Developed regions exhibit higher average selling prices due to stringent quality standards, advanced features, and higher labor costs in manufacturing. Conversely, price-sensitive markets in Asia-Pacific and Latin America benefit from locally manufactured devices that offer competitive pricing without significant compromise on quality. For example, India’s expanding Arthroscopic Devices Manufacturing sector has introduced devices priced 20-30% lower than imported alternatives, significantly boosting regional market penetration.
Reimbursement policies and healthcare funding also play a crucial role in shaping price trends. In countries where arthroscopic procedures are covered by insurance or government healthcare schemes, demand is more price inelastic, allowing manufacturers to maintain premium pricing. In contrast, in regions with limited reimbursement, price sensitivity among providers and patients drives demand for more affordable device options, influencing manufacturing focus and market segmentation.

Recent Developments and Industry News
The Arthroscopic Devices Market has witnessed several notable developments in recent months, reflecting the industry’s dynamic nature and the ongoing efforts of manufacturers to enhance their product offerings.
- March 2025: Smith & Nephew announced the launch of its next-generation Werewolf Fastseal 6.0 Hemostasis Wand, designed to improve soft tissue management and bleeding control during arthroscopic procedures. This innovation aims to enhance surgical efficiency and patient outcomes.
- January 2025: Arthrex introduced the NanoNeedle Scope System, a miniaturized arthroscopy platform that allows for minimally invasive joint assessments using needle-sized incisions. This advancement supports in-office diagnostic procedures, reducing the need for full operating room interventions.
- December 2024: Healthium Medtech inaugurated an arthroscopy product manufacturing facility in Ahmedabad, India. The facility aims to produce devices for treating knee and shoulder conditions, including anterior cruciate ligament reconstruction, thereby expanding the company’s footprint in the global market.
These developments underscore the industry’s commitment to advancing arthroscopic technologies and meeting the evolving needs of healthcare providers and patients.
